Flannery used 3030 30 lilies and 7878 78 roses to create six identical flower arrangements. Write an equation to describe the relationship between ll l , the number of lilies, and rr r , the number of roses.

We have that, total number of lilies used = 30 and total number of roses used = 78.

So, the total number of flowers are = 30 + 78 = 108

Let, l = number of lilies in one arrangement and r = number of roses in one arrangement.

Since, it is required to make 6 identical arrangements.

So, number of lilies in 6 arrangements = 6l and number of roses in 6 arrangements = 6r

Thus, we get the relation between lilies and roses as 6l + 6r = 108.
